Does Dr. Moss treat kidney stones?

Yes, kidney stone management is a core part of urological practice, and Dr. Moss evaluates and treats patients with acute and recurrent kidney stones. Treatment options may include medical management, shockwave lithotripsy, or minimally invasive surgical procedures depending on the size and location of the stone. Patients experiencing severe flank pain or blood in the urine should seek prompt evaluation.

Does Dr. Moss see patients for enlarged prostate or BPH?

Benign prostatic hyperplasia is one of the most common conditions urologists treat, and Dr. Moss offers both medical and surgical options for men experiencing urinary symptoms related to an enlarged prostate. Treatment recommendations are based on symptom severity and individual health factors. Men noticing weak urine flow, frequent urination, or difficulty emptying the bladder should schedule an evaluation.

Does Dr. Moss treat urinary incontinence?

Yes, urinary incontinence is a condition Dr. Moss evaluates and manages for both men and women. Treatment options range from behavioral modifications and pelvic floor therapy referrals to minimally invasive procedures and surgical interventions. A thorough evaluation helps determine which approach is most appropriate for each patient.
